Lucymarie is a unique and beautiful name of Latin origin. It is composed of two elements: "Lucy," which comes from the Latin word "lux," meaning "light"; and "Marie," which is derived from the Latin name "Maria," meaning "sea of bitterness" or "rebelliousness."

The name Lucymarie is believed to have originated in Spain, where it was given to girls born into Catholic families. The use of this name may have been influenced by the veneration of Saint Lucy, who was a martyr during the Roman Empire's persecution of Christians.

Saint Lucy is celebrated on December 13th and is associated with light, as her name implies. Legend has it that she brought light to those in darkness, both literally and metaphorically, and this theme may have contributed to the popularity of the name Lucymarie among Catholic families.
